Education benefits are among the most valuable rewards of military service. Illinois veterans have access to federal programs like the GI Bill plus state-specific education benefits that can cover tuition, fees, and living expenses. With approximately 620,000 veterans in the state, Illinois has built support systems to help veterans succeed academically.

Naperville Veterans Upward Bound

Department of Education-funded TRIO Veterans Upward Bound program serving Naperville-area veterans. Free academic refresher courses, college application help, financial aid guidance, and transition support for postsecondary success.

VR&E (Chapter 31) Counselor - Naperville

Vocational Rehabilitation and Employment (Chapter 31, VR&E) services for service-connected Naperville veterans pursuing employment, self-employment, or independent living. Tuition, fees, books, and a monthly subsistence allowance may be covered.

Naperville American Job Center - Veterans Services

Department of Labor American Job Center serving Naperville veterans. Priority of service, Local Veterans Employment Representative (LVER) and Disabled Veterans Outreach Program (DVOP) staffing, training referrals, and resume support.
